ANGER, AUGUST H., 92, of 108 10th Ave. N, died Saturday (Aug. 30, 1986) at his residence. He came here in 1950 from his native Pittsburgh, where he was a chief draftsman for Lewis Foundry. He was a member and former elder of First Presbyterian Church and member of the former Pittsburgh Social Club.
Survivors include two sons, Charles A., St. Petersburg, and William H., St. Louis; five grandchildren, 17 great-grandchildren and one great-great-grandchild. John S. Rhodes, East Chapel.
